Gpu multithreading
WebOct 18, 2024 · Multithreading, a graphical processing unit (GPU) executes multiple threads in parallel, the operating system supports. The threads share a single or multiple cores, including the graphical units, the …
Gpu multithreading
Did you know?
WebJun 26, 2024 · The CUDA runtime API is state-based, and threads execute cudaSetDevice () to set the current GPU. After this call all CUDA API commands go to the current set … WebApr 23, 2024 · Multithreading enables the CPU to run the render thread while the communication thread is waiting for a response from the server, increasing the CPU utilisation. Note that multithreading is not to be confused with multi-processing. Modern CPUs have multiple cores; multi-processing utilizes these cores to run processes in parallel.
WebJan 3, 2024 · You should call wglShareLists as soon as possible, meaning before you create any resources. You can then make GL rendering context 1 current in thread1 and make GL rendering context 2 current in thread2 at the same time. If you upload a texture from thread2, then it will be available in thread1. Example : WebDec 4, 2009 · “The following concepts are largely irrelevant for GPU threads: lock, semaphore, mutex, fork, join, message queue. Therefore ‘porting’ a typical multi-threaded algorithm from OpenMP to CUDA is no easier (and probably somewhat harder) than working from a simple single-threaded prototype of the algorithm. The multi-threading aspect of …
WebSep 15, 2016 · Revise the base AutoCAD code to support multi-core processors for ALL operations - not just redraw, regen, and rendering. It is almost impossible to buy a single core CPU anymore and quad core is becoming the standard. Therefore with a 2GHz processors you only have a 500MHz CPU when running CAD. WebFeb 19, 2024 · The previously mentioned TensorFlow Wasm benchmarks reveal that SIMD is responsible for a 1.7 to 4.5 performance improvement factor vs. vanilla Wasm, while multi-threading produces an additional 1 ...
WebDefine the kernel function (s) (code to be run on parallel on the GPU) In simplest model, one kernel is executed at a time and then control returns to CPU. Many threads execute one kernel. Allocate space on the CPU for …
WebThe game thread blocks at the end of each Tick () until the rendering thread catches up to either one frame or two frames behind. Since the rendering thread is so far behind, it is never acceptable during gameplay to block the game thread until the rendering thread catches up completely. top 10 friday night smackdownWebMar 13, 2024 · Needed help to use multi-threading on GPUs Python Help help divyanshusingh (Divyanshu Kumar) March 12, 2024, 12:30pm #1 Hi, I’m Divyanshu. I am trying to implement multi-threading on GPUs. I am using amazon sagemaker’s Jupyter Lab as the interface. top 10 fridge freezersWebApr 7, 2024 · Multithreading in the video driver should allow performance increases when running 3D games and applications on dual-core CPUs and multiprocessor PCs. De Waal estimated that dual-core processors... pichet le tholonetWebJan 24, 2024 · A GPU has so many more cores, that this approach does not work. The execution model of GPUs is different: more than two … pichet location angoulêmeWebApr 5, 2011 · GPU hardware is optimized for this kind of load. It aims at combining a maximum number of simple parallel-processing elements, each having only a small amount of local memory. For example, the... pichet location bloisWeb50 minutes ago · 2 minutes ago. #1. Intel Graphics today released the latest version of the Arc GPU Graphics drivers. Version 101.4311 beta comes with GameOn optimization for "Dead Island 2," "Total War: Warhammer III - Mirror of Madness," "Minecraft Legends," and "Boundary." It also introduces major post-optimizations for "Dead Space" (Remake), with … top 10 fridge in indiaWebJun 26, 2024 · We often say that to reach high performance on GPUs you should expose as much parallelism in your code as possible, and we don’t mean just parallelism within one GPU, but also across multiple GPUs and CPUs. It’s common for high-performance software to parallelize across multiple GPUs by assigning one or more CPU threads to each GPU. top 10 fried chicken in usa